Los Aeroprakt A-22, producidos localmente y con un valor de venta al p\u00fablico de unos US$ 90.000, fueron modificados con la incorporaci\u00f3n de las capacidades de vuelo aut\u00f3nomo necesarias , para recorrer una distancia cercana a las 600 millas, llevando cargas explosivas de cientos de kg. El ataque que sorprendi\u00f3 a los Sist Def Ae de Rusia, no pudo ser neutralizado pese a la escasa velocidad y vuelo a baja altura de los drones, impactando el objetivo y produciendo da\u00f1os materiales y v\u00edctimas en el complejo fabril, donde la informaci\u00f3n de Icia indicaba que era el sitio de montaje de UAS Shahed \u2013 136, provistos por Ir\u00e1n a Rusia. A high-wing, single-propeller sport plane with room for two.<\/p>\n<p>That the Ukrainians could convert an A-22 into an explosive drone strongly implies the strike on the Alabuga facility, which reportedly assembles Iranian-designed Shahed drones for Russia\u2019s own war effort, won\u2019t be the last for this new drone type.<\/p>\n<p>The simple, reliable and innocuous A-22 after all lends itself to drone conversion. And equally importantly, it\u2019s made in Ukraine\u2014and it\u2019s affordable at just $90,000 a copy.<\/p>\n<p>To put that into perspective: an A-22-based drone, capable of traveling 600 miles through Russian air defenses to deliver\u2014with high accuracy\u2014potentially hundreds of pounds of explosives, costs just slightly more than a single American-made Javelin anti-tank missile costs. Ukrainian troops fire Javelins by the hundred.<\/p>\n<p>An A-22 drone is, on a production level, scalable. Remember that, in 2019, the U.S. Air Force stripped the seats and controls out of a 1968-vintage Cessna 206 light plane and installed, in their place, a set of computer-driven servos.<\/p>\n<p>\u201cThe system \u2018grabs\u2019 the yoke, pushes on the rudders and brakes, controls the throttle, flips the appropriate switches and reads the dashboard gauges the same way a pilot does,\u201d the Air Force Research Laboratories\u00a0<a class=\"color-link\" title=\"https:\/\/www.wpafb.af.mil\/News\/Article-Display\/Article\/1935442\/air-force-research-laboratory-successfully-conducts-first-flight-of-robopilot-u\/\" href=\"https:\/\/www.wpafb.af.mil\/News\/Article-Display\/Article\/1935442\/air-force-research-laboratory-successfully-conducts-first-flight-of-robopilot-u\/\" target=\"_blank\" rel=\"nofollow noopener noreferrer\" data-ga-track=\"ExternalLink:https:\/\/www.wpafb.af.mil\/News\/Article-Display\/Article\/1935442\/air-force-research-laboratory-successfully-conducts-first-flight-of-robopilot-u\/\" aria-label=\"explained\">explained<\/a>. \u201cAt the same time, the system uses sensors, like GPS and an inertial measurement unit, for situational awareness and information-gathering. A computer analyzes these details to make decisions on how to best control the flight.\u201d<\/p>\n<p>\u201cImagine being able to rapidly and affordably convert a general aviation aircraft, like a Cessna or Piper, into an unmanned aerial vehicle, having it fly a mission autonomously, and then returning it back to its original manned configuration,\u201d said Alok Das, an AFRL scientist. \u201cAll of this is achieved without making permanent modifications to the aircraft.\u201d<\/p>\n<p>In the case of the A-22 drone, the Ukrainians clearly aren\u2019t worried about uninstalling the autonomous controls. The drone is, in effect, a slow cruise missile. It\u2019s not supposed to return to base.<\/p>\n<p>And as a cruise missile, the A-22 is a real bargain. Counting the price of the new controls and the explosive payload, an A-22 drone might cost a few hundred thousand dollars.<\/p>\n<p>That\u2019s cheaper than Ukraine\u2019s locally-made Neptune cruise missile, which costs around $500,000. And it\u2019s\u00a0<em>much\u00a0<\/em>cheaper than the $3-million Storm Shadow cruise missiles Ukraine has received from the United Kingdom.<\/p>\n<p>As a bonus, an A-22 with its approximately 600-mile range outdistances the Neptune and the Storm Shadow, both of which travel no farther than 200 miles.<\/p>\n<p>The main downside of the sport plane cruise missile is its low speed: at most, 126 miles per hour, compared to the 600 miles per hour a Storm Shadow can sustain.<\/p>\n<p>In theory, that makes an A-22-based drone vulnerable to Russian air defenses. In practice, air defenses are spread thin across the vastness of Russia\u2019s interior.
